Jake Gyllenhaal was born on December 19, 1980, in the vibrant city of Los Angeles, California, to a family with a rich cultural heritage. His parents, Naomi Foner and Stephen Gyllenhaal, were a producer and director, respectively, and his older sister, Maggie Gyllenhaal, is also an accomplished actress. This unique blend of Ashkenazi Jewish, Swedish, English, and German ancestry has undoubtedly influenced Jake's artistic journey.
As a young actor, Jake made his movie debut at the tender age of 11 in the 1991 film City Slickers. Throughout the late 1990s and early 2000s, he continued to hone his craft, starring in notable films such as October Sky (1999) and Donnie Darko (2001). His performance in Donnie Darko earned him an Independent Spirit Award nomination for Best Actor.
Jake's versatility as an actor was showcased in a range of roles during the early 2000s, including Bubble Boy (2001),The Good Girl (2002),Moonlight Mile (2002),and The Day After Tomorrow (2004). He made his theatrical debut in a revival of This Is Our Youth in London, which received critical acclaim and played for eight weeks on the West End.
The mid-2000s saw Jake take on more mature roles, starring in Jarhead (2005) and Proof (2005). However, it was his performance in Brokeback Mountain (2005) that earned him widespread critical acclaim and numerous award nominations, including the BAFTA Award for Best Actor in a Supporting Role.
In the following years, Jake continued to impress audiences with his performances in Zodiac (2007),Brothers (2009),Prince of Persia: The Sands of Time (2010),and Love & Other Drugs (2010). His portrayal of Jamie Randall in Love & Other Drugs earned him a Golden Globe nomination for Best Actor-Motion Picture Musical or Comedy.
The 2010s saw Jake take on a diverse range of roles, starring in Source Code (2011),End of Watch (2012),Prisoners (2013),Nightcrawler (2014),Southpaw (2015),and Demolition (2015). His performance in Nightcrawler earned him a Golden Globe nomination for Best Actor in a Motion Picture Drama, as well as a SAG and BAFTA Award nomination.
